FlyExclusive has announced a significant investment of $25.8 million from ETG FE, an investment vehicle managed by EnTrust Global. The funds will be used to support the company’s fractional aircraft program as part of its strategic plan to become a fully integrated private aviation company. This investment follows FlyExclusive’s recent business combination with EG Acquisition Corp., sponsored by EnTrust Global and GMF Capital. The company continues to expand its operations and secure funding for its growth initiatives, including the development of a new headquarters and pilot training center.
